    manual 4th axis milling


    Hey guys.
    I have a custom job to fabricate a couple of this benches. The legs are fluted with continuously changing radius. Perfect job for CNC.
    I am eagerly waiting for CNCRP to start selling 4th axis kit which would make continuous 4th axis machining a bliss but for now this is a question of positioning and indexing the stock.

    I have an old Vertex dividing head and a tail stock. Looks perfect for 4 sided flip milling. Actually, almost as many sided flips as I wish. Divider will go up to a 100 if I remember correctly.
    Ordered 1 pc Lathe Chuck 6" 4Jaw Independent w/Back Plate 1-1/2"-8TPI K72-160 sct-888 with the backing plate.
    Going to be setting up to mill on Sat.
    Any recommendations on small CNC bits to clean the fluting?
